Do I need to install JDK(Java Development Kit) separately for using . . . 64 Android Studio version 2 2 and higher comes with the latest OpenJDK embedded in order to have a low barrier to entry for beginners It is, however, recommended to have the JDK installed on your own as you are then able to update it independent of Android Studio

How to use Android Studio on very low-end laptops? - Reddit You could also try to write as much as possible in java or kotlin without android studio, and create automated tests for most of the behavior Java and Kotlin can run on very basic laptops, much easier than running the full android studio Then aside from the UI stuff, you can reuse the classes and libraries you create
Manually install Gradle and use it in Android Studio Android Studio will automatically use the Gradle wrapper and pull the correct version of Gradle rather than use a locally installed version If you wish to use a new version of Gradle, you can change the version used by studio

Android Studio Not Including SDK - Stack Overflow Old answer It seems the android-studio-bundle version is no longer available in the download page (instead there are only android-studio-ide) When you start Android Studio, it won't let you create a new projet until you configure the SDK location
